Where does “oneindigheid” come from?

oneindigheid (Dutch) comes from Dutch oneindig, from Dutch eindig, from Dutch eind, from Dutch einde, from Middle Dutch ende, from Old Dutch endi, from Proto-West Germanic andī, from Proto-Germanic andijaz — on, onto.

oneindigheid (Dutch): infinity
